AN ACT Relating to headlight use requirements; and amending RCW 46.37.020 and 46.37.040.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WASHINGTON:
Sec. 1.  RCW 46.37.020 and 1977 ex.s. c 355 s 2 are each amended to read as follows:
(1) Every vehicle upon a highway within this state at any time from a half hour after sunset to a half hour before sunrise ((and at any other time when, due to insufficient light or unfavorable atmospheric conditions, persons and vehicles on the highway are not clearly discernible at a distance of one thousand feet ahead shall))must display lighted headlights, other lights, and illuminating devices as hereinafter respectively required for different classes of vehicles, subject to exceptions with respect to parked vehicles, and such stop lights, turn signals, and other signaling devices shall be lighted as prescribed for the use of such devices.
(2) Subject to subsection (3) of this section, from thirty minutes before sunrise to thirty minutes after sunset, every vehicle operating on a highway within this state must:
(a) Use head lamps lit at low beam, if the vehicle was manufactured before January 1, 2018, and is not equipped with daytime running head lamps; or
(b) Use daytime running head lamps, if the vehicle is equipped with daytime running head lamps.
(3) Head lamps lit at low beam or high beam must be used at any time when, due to insufficient light or unfavorable atmospheric conditions, persons and vehicles on the highway are not clearly discernible at a distance of one thousand feet ahead.
Sec. 2.  RCW 46.37.040 and 1977 ex.s. c 355 s 4 are each amended to read as follows:
(1) Every motor vehicle shall be equipped with at least two head lamps with at least one on each side of the front of the motor vehicle, which head lamps shall comply with the requirements and limitations set forth in this chapter.
(2) Every head lamp upon every motor vehicle shall be located at a height measured from the center of the head lamp of not more than fifty-four inches nor less than twenty-four inches to be measured as set forth in RCW 46.37.030(2).
(3) Every motor vehicle offered for sale in Washington, manufactured after January 1, 2018, must be equipped with daytime running head lamps.
